West Brom Faces Pressure to Sack Eric Ramsay Amidst Fan Discontent
West Bromwich Albion is under mounting pressure to part ways with manager Eric Ramsay as fans voice their frustrations following yet another defeat. In their latest outing, the Baggies were eliminated from the FA Cup by Norwich City, with a scoreline of 3-1 at Carrow Road. This unfortunate result now marks a dismal seven-match winless streak for Ramsay since he took charge of the team.

The discontent among the supporters is palpable, as echoes of dissatisfaction resonate through the stands. Former assistant manager Mick Brown remarked that Ramsay’s position could quickly become untenable if he fails to engage the fans positively. Just over a month into his tenure, Ramsay now finds his team entrenched in a relegation fight, compounded by their recent exit from the FA Cup.
Since Ramsay’s appointment, West Brom has plummeted to the bottom of the Championship table, with just two points separating them from Leicester City, who are also in danger of relegation. With the club’s future at stake, the pressure is intensifying for Ramsay to deliver results. The discourse around his leadership suggests that the fans’ expectations are not being met, and calls for his removal are growing louder.
Brown emphasized that frequent losses will inevitably lead to questions about the manager’s capability. “If you’re losing regularly, the spotlight will always be on the manager,” he stated. “Fans at West Brom have high expectations, and if those aren’t met, the pressure mounts significantly.” The team’s failure to secure wins has left them in a precarious position, making the upcoming matches crucial for Ramsay’s future.
